Delight your family and friends with this Cheesy Steak Burrito Bake, a comforting and satisfying dish that brings the flavors of Mexico straight to your kitchen. Featuring tender sirloin tip steak sautéed with zesty taco seasoning, creamy refried beans, and a blend of gooey cheeses, this casserole is a perfect choice for gatherings. With its mildly seasoned ingredients, even the pickiest eaters will enjoy this hearty meal. The burritos are generously topped with a savory enchilada sauce and gratinated with Mexican cheese blend before baking to perfection. Ideal for potlucks, family meals, or simply a cozy night in, this recipe is sure to become a family favorite!

Cheesy Steak Burrito Bake instructions

Ingredients

Butter 1/2 cup (melted)
Taco seasoning mix 1 (2 1/2 ounce) package (n/a)
Sirloin tip steaks 1 1/2 lbs (cut into 1 inch strips)
Refried beans 1 (16 ounce) can (warmed)
Shredded cheddar cheese 2 cups (n/a)
Green onions 3 (thinly sliced)
Red enchilada sauce 1 (10 ounce) can (n/a)
Shredded Mexican blend cheese 1 cup (n/a)
Flour tortillas (fajita size) 8 small (warmed)

Instructions

1
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
2
Grease a 13x9 inch baking pan lightly and set aside.
3
In a large skillet, melt the butter over medium heat.
4
Add the taco seasoning to the melted butter and stir well until combined.
5
Introduce the beef strips into the skillet and cook, stirring occasionally, until the meat is browned. Drain any excess fat.
6
While the beef cooks, warm the refried beans in a microwave-safe bowl for about 2 minutes until heated through.
7
Warm the flour tortillas in the microwave for about 30 seconds to make them pliable.
8
Spread a generous layer of warm refried beans onto each tortilla, leaving a 1/4 inch border around the edges.
9
Top each tortilla with a portion of the cooked steak, a sprinkle of shredded cheddar cheese, and a few slices of green onion.
10
Carefully roll up the tortillas, folding in the sides to create a burrito shape, and place them seam-side down in the prepared baking pan.
11
Once all the burritos are in the pan, pour the red enchilada sauce evenly over the top, ensuring each burrito is well-coated.
12
Sprinkle the shredded Mexican cheese blend generously over the enchilada sauce.
13
Bake in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es, or until the burritos are heated through and the cheese is bubbly and melted.
14
Let cool slightly before serving, and enjoy your deliciously cheesy steak burrito bake!
